Hehehehehe

Se eu fosse o Banco do Brasil naum estaria preocupado com o banco de Dados
pq eles tem um contrato vitalicio com os grandes players do mercado...

a questaum � q qdo vc cria um software de crescente sucesso e qualidade, vc
come�a a lidar com varias situa��es...e hj a minha aplica��o � 100% portavel
a nivel de banco de dados...e o servidor de aplica��o e a parte mais
riducula de distribuir, visto q roda em memoria...
em alguns casos naum e comum mudar o banco..mas em outros � extremamente
necess�rio..e naum � so a portablilidade q me leva a usar n-tier, mas sim
ganho de processamento e tempo de resposta, centraliza��o de regras e
balanceamentode carga, economia de grana num possivel gargalo de
processamento.
N�o digo q seja o ideal para tosas as situa��es...e hehehe...e claro q qdo a
sua ferramenta de desenvolvimento � o Delphi e vc tem celulas de negocios
bem definidas e uma boa arquitetura no software vc programa   TODOS os
servidores de aplica��o da mesma forma... mas os bancos de dados, os
comandos saum diferentes, e a forma de tratamento de determinados tipos de
dados tb s�o diferentes...no servidor de aplica��o � td Delphi.

Galera, n�o estou puxando sardinha para n-tier, pelo contrario estou expondo
os pontos positivos e esclarecendo mitos q acontecem em torno deste
paradigma...

as ordens

;-)

[]�s
Bruno Lichot
Gerente de Novas Tecnologias - Micrologos
Equipe ClubeDelphi.NET
DevMedia Group

www.micrologos.com.br - www.clubedelphi.net -
www.delphirio.assespro-rj.org.br
www.sqlmagazine.com.br - www.neoficio.com.br/msdn - www.javamagazine.com.br
www.portalwebmobile.com.br
----- Original Message -----
From: "Rodrigo Othavio Farias" <[EMAIL PROTECTED]>
To: <[email protected]>
Sent: Thursday, February 03, 2005 3:25 PM
Subject: Re: [delphi-br] Firebir + MySQL+PostegreSQL


>
> Nao querendo polemizar, mas procedures e views s�o portaveis com pequenos
> ajustes para varios bancos, al�m do que mudar de banco nao � algo comum,
> dificilmente algu�m troca sua solu��o de banco de dados, j� trocar o
> servidor de aplica��o � muito comum.
>
> Eu gerencio aplica��es que rodam em mais de 1000 esta��es simultaneamente,
e
> os sistemas s� rodam de maneira satisfat�ria gra�as ao banco de dados,
> robusto e com procedures otimizadas, pra mim parece bobagem nao usar todos
> os recursos disponiveis no banco, ele nao vao ser mudado, seria loucura
> passar uma base base de dados com centenas de gygabites numa aventura de
> troca de fornecedor de banco de dados.
> Mas o meu caso � de uma institui��o, nao fabrico software para varios
> clientes, nesse caso de varios clientes uma independ�ncia do banco pode
ser
> boa, mas da mesma forma que nao se consegue programar de forma unica para
> varios bancos tb nao existe forma unica de se montar servidores de
> aplica��es. At� hoje nao vi nem em Java algo 100% portavel.
>
>
>
>
> []�s
> Rodrigo O. Farias
> ----- Original Message -----
> From: Bruno Lichot - Micrologos
> To: [email protected]
> Sent: Thursday, February 03, 2005 8:09 AM
> Subject: Re: [delphi-br] Firebir + MySQL+PostegreSQL
>
>
> Lembrando q desta forma vc fica preso tecnologicamente ao banco e perde
> portabilidade,escalabilidade e aumenta o custo num possivel gargalo de
> processamento.
> Se vc utilizar desenvolvimento multicamadas, colocando seus codigos de
> procedures e regras de negocio no servidor de aplica��o vc ganha
> independencia de banco, aumenta sua portabilidade e escalabilidade,
melhora
> o tempo de resposta e diminui o custo de solucionar um possivel gargalo de
> processamento entre outras vantagens.
> N�o estou falando q este � o modelo perfeito, apensa estou adicionando
> informa��o para q se possa usar o melhor de cada arquitetura.
> No meu caso, n�o uso nenhuma tecnologia proprietaria no banco... fa�o td
nos
> meus servidores de aplica��o e minhas aplica��es s�o de gest�o de clinicas
> medicas e hospitais...aplica�es grandes e q funcionam perfeitamente bem
> obrigado... temos uns 3000 clientes...
>
> as ordens
>
> []�s
> Bruno Lichot
> Gerente de Novas Tecnologias - Micrologos
> Equipe ClubeDelphi.NET
> DevMedia Group
>
> www.micrologos.com.br - www.clubedelphi.net -
> www.delphirio.assespro-rj.org.br
> www.sqlmagazine.com.br - www.neoficio.com.br/msdn -
www.javamagazine.com.br
> www.portalwebmobile.com.br
>
> ----- Original Message -----
> From: "Rodrigo Othavio Farias" <[EMAIL PROTECTED]>
> To: <[email protected]>
> Sent: Wednesday, February 02, 2005 4:59 PM
> Subject: Re: [delphi-br] Firebir + MySQL+PostegreSQL
>
>
> >
> > S� pra complementar o Alexandre que foi �timo na explica��o, �
> aconselhavel
> > o uso de views e Stored Procedures, usando esses recursos do banco vc
> deixa
> > grande parte do processamento no servidor, al�m do que as views e Stored
> > Procedures s�o compiladas no servidor, ocasionando um tremendo ganho de
> > performance, Evitem a todo custo rodar querys do cliente.
> >
> >
> > []�s
> > Rodrigo O. Farias
> >
> > ----- Original Message -----
> > From: CPD (Borborema-Imperial Transportes Ltda)
> > To: [email protected]
> > Sent: Wednesday, February 02, 2005 2:47 PM
> > Subject: [delphi-br] Firebir + MySQL+PostegreSQL
> >
> >
> > Eu utilizo i FireBird com Links de 128 e 256 e est� dando conta do
recado,
> > eu simplismente coloquei o Zebedee para compactar e Criptografar o
tr�fego
> e
> > resolvi o problema de taxa de dados e seguran�a, olha que tenho uma
> > quantidade de acesso constante. Temos que lembrar tamb�m de trabalhar
> nossas
> > Query melhor, tem profissionais que gosta da facilidade de utilizar
select
> *
> > from tabela, temos que lembrar que uma boa aplica��o utiliza Query
> dinamicas
> > e sem o *. Temos que passar todo o processamento para o Servidor e
> utilizar
> > as esta��es somente como cliente, este motivo ainda temos micros 166,
266
> > com 32/64 MB de ram trabalhando sem problemas com o (Win98 ou Win2000) +
> > Delphi 7 + FB 1.5.2 + Zeos.
> >
> > Alexandre C Souza
> >
> >
> >
> > --
> > No virus found in this outgoing message.
> > Checked by AVG Anti-Virus.
> > Version: 7.0.300 / Virus Database: 265.8.2 - Release Date: 28/01/2005
> >
> >
> >
> > --
> > <<<<< FAVOR REMOVER ESTA PARTE AO RESPONDER ESTA MENSAGEM >>>>>
> >
> > Para ver as mensagens antigas, acesse:
> > http://br.groups.yahoo.com/group/delphi-br/messages
> >
> > Para falar com o moderador, envie um e-mail para:
> > [EMAIL PROTECTED] ou [EMAIL PROTECTED]
> >
> >
> >
> > Yahoo! Grupos, um servi�o oferecido por:
> >
> >
> >
> >
> > --
> > <<<<< FAVOR REMOVER ESTA PARTE AO RESPONDER ESTA MENSAGEM >>>>>
> >
> > Para ver as mensagens antigas, acesse:
> >  http://br.groups.yahoo.com/group/delphi-br/messages
> >
> > Para falar com o moderador, envie um e-mail para:
> >  [EMAIL PROTECTED] ou [EMAIL PROTECTED]
> >
> > Links do Yahoo! Grupos
> >
> >
> >
> >
> >
> >
> >
> >
> >
>
>
>
>
> --
> <<<<< FAVOR REMOVER ESTA PARTE AO RESPONDER ESTA MENSAGEM >>>>>
>
> Para ver as mensagens antigas, acesse:
> http://br.groups.yahoo.com/group/delphi-br/messages
>
> Para falar com o moderador, envie um e-mail para:
> [EMAIL PROTECTED] ou [EMAIL PROTECTED]
>
>
>
> Yahoo! Grupos, um servi�o oferecido por:
>
>  S�o Paulo Rio de Janeiro Curitiba Porto Alegre Belo Horizonte Bras�lia
>
>
>
>
>
> Links do Yahoo! Grupos
>
> Para visitar o site do seu grupo na web, acesse:
> http://br.groups.yahoo.com/group/delphi-br/
>
> Para sair deste grupo, envie um e-mail para:
> [EMAIL PROTECTED]
>
> O uso que voc� faz do Yahoo! Grupos est� sujeito aos Termos do Servi�o do
> Yahoo!.
>
>
>
> --
> <<<<< FAVOR REMOVER ESTA PARTE AO RESPONDER ESTA MENSAGEM >>>>>
>
> Para ver as mensagens antigas, acesse:
>  http://br.groups.yahoo.com/group/delphi-br/messages
>
> Para falar com o moderador, envie um e-mail para:
>  [EMAIL PROTECTED] ou [EMAIL PROTECTED]
>
> Links do Yahoo! Grupos
>
>
>
>
>
>
>
>
>




-- 
<<<<< FAVOR REMOVER ESTA PARTE AO RESPONDER ESTA MENSAGEM >>>>>

Para ver as mensagens antigas, acesse:
 http://br.groups.yahoo.com/group/delphi-br/messages

Para falar com o moderador, envie um e-mail para:
 [EMAIL PROTECTED] ou [EMAIL PROTECTED]
 
Links do Yahoo! Grupos

<*> Para visitar o site do seu grupo na web, acesse:
    http://br.groups.yahoo.com/group/delphi-br/

<*> Para sair deste grupo, envie um e-mail para:
    [EMAIL PROTECTED]

<*> O uso que voc� faz do Yahoo! Grupos est� sujeito aos:
    http://br.yahoo.com/info/utos.html

 



Responder a